【java – @Value(“${local.server.port}”)无法在Spring boot 1.5中运行】教程文章相关的互联网学习教程文章

Spring基于java的配置【代码】【图】

我们之前都了解过spring基于xml的配置,我们也可以通过配置类来完成基于xml的配置,我们会在下面以一个例子来讲述一下Spring基于java的配置。 首先第一步准备工作: 1)创建一个Dog类 1 package com.youzicha.pojo;2 3 public class Dog {4 private String dogName;5 6 public String getDogName() {7 return dogName;8 }9 10 public void setDogName(String dogName) { 11 this.dogName = dogNa...

Spring源码-循环依赖,Java架构师必学【代码】【图】

Spring 在哪些情况下会出现循环依赖错误?哪些情况下能自身解决循环依赖,又是如何解决的?本文将介绍笔者通过本地调试 Spring 源码来观察循环依赖的过程。1. 注解属性注入 首先本地准备好一份 Spring 源码,笔者是从 Github 上 Clone 下来的一份,然后用 IDEA 导入,再创建一个 module 用于存放调试的代码。 另外大家也要注意:不管你是为了JAVA高薪还是爱好,记住:项目开发经验永远是核心,如果你没有最新JAVA架构实战视频教程及...

SpringBoot整合并使用Java实现“孤立森林”异常数据过滤算法【代码】

实现背景和意义 在物联网应用中,数据的产生大多数都是由传感器采集的,农业物联网更是如此。并且农业物联网中,传感器采集环境更加极端,十分容易发生传感器数据采集异常事件,这些异常的输入随传输协议进入数据库,必然会对本系统的数据库产生污染,影响应用可靠性。所以对异常数据应该采取过滤的方式达到不对应用可靠性产生负面影响的效果。 在我自己的智能水培项目中中,物联网的环境数据由温度、湿度、PH值、EC值、CO2浓度、光...

springmvc:Lookup method resolution failed; nested exception is java.lang.IllegalStateException: Fail【代码】【图】

1、在测试springmvc程序的时候报错:Lookup method resolution failed; nested exception is java.lang.IllegalStateException: Failed to introspect Class [pers.zhb.controller.TeacherController] from ClassLoader [ParallelWebappClassLoader这里用的是maven,工具是IDEA,依赖的jar包均已经导入成功,但是依旧报500错误 2、解决方案 这个错误类似于IDEA的一个bug,在导入依赖后还需要进行其他的操作: (1)进入project.....

SpringAOP注解报错:java.lang.IllegalArgumentException: error at ::0 can't find referenced pointcut s【图】

原因 我使用的aspectjweaver.jar版本是1.5.1,版本过低,导致报错。 需要下载高本版的aspectjweaver.jar。 解决办法 在这里下载:https://mvnrepository.com/artifact/org.aspectj/aspectjweaverhttps://mvnrepository.com/artifact/org.aspectj/aspectjweaver然后再将jar包导入到项目中,运行成功!

Spring 基于 Java 的配置【代码】

前面已经学习如何使用 XML 配置文件来配置 Spring bean。 基于 Java 的配置可以达到基于XML配置的相同效果。 基于 Java 的配置选项,可以使你在不用配置 XML 的情况下编写大多数的 Spring @Configuration 和 @Bean 注解 带有 @Configuration 的注解类表示这个类可以使用 Spring IoC 容器作为 bean 定义的来源。 @Bean 注解告诉 Spring,一个带有 @Bean 的注解方法将返回一个对象,该对象应该被注册为在 Spring 应用程序上下文中的 ...

[java]一分钟学会spring注解之@Import注解【代码】

一分钟学会spring注解之@Import注解 今天主要从以下几方面来介绍一下@Import注解@Import注解是什么@Import的三种使用方式1,@Import注解是什么 通过导入的方式实现把实例加入springIOC容器中 2,@Import的三种使用方式 通过查看@Import源码可以发现@Import注解只能注解在类上,以及唯一的参数value上可以配置3种类型的值 Configuration, ImportSelector, ImportBeanDefinitionRegistrar,源码如下: @Target(ElementType.TYPE) @...

牛批!阿里P8Java架构师写了一份Spring MVC教程,已整理成文档。【图】

写在前面 Spring MVC是当前最优秀的MVC框架,自从Spring 2.5版本发布后,由于支持注解配置,易用性有了大幅度的提高。Spring 3.0更加完善,实现了对Struts 2的超越。现在越来越多的开发团队选择了Spring MVC。 Spring3 MVC的优点:1、Spring3 MVC使用简单,学习成本低。2、Spring3 MVC很容易就可以写出性能优秀的程序。3、Spring3 MVC的灵活是你无法想像的,Spring框架的扩展性有口皆碑,Spring MVC当然也不会落后,不会因使用了MV...

牛批!阿里P8Java架构师写了一份Spring MVC教程,已整理成文档。【图】

写在前面Spring MVC是当前最优秀的MVC框架,自从Spring 2.5版本发布后,由于支持注解配置,易用性有了大幅度的提高。Spring 3.0更加完善,实现了对Struts 2的超越。现在越来越多的开发团队选择了Spring MVC。Spring3 MVC的优点:1、Spring3 MVC使用简单,学习成本低。2、Spring3 MVC很容易就可以写出性能优秀的程序。3、Spring3 MVC的灵活是你无法想像的,Spring框架的扩展性有口皆碑,Spring MVC当然也不会落后,不会因使用了MVC框...

Spring框架配置java_web的实例化【代码】

java_web的IOC的初始化,是在初始化Tomcat时自动配置 配置spring-web。jar(spring.web包)提供的监听器,此监听器乐意在服务器启动是初始化IOC容器初始化Ioc容易(applicationcontext.xml),1、必须告诉监听器此容易的位置:context_param 2、使用默认约定位置,applicationContext.xml必须放在WEB-INF下面且名字必须是这个名字<?xml version="1.0" encoding="UTF-8"?> <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ema...

蘑菇街Java大牛纯手写肛出的(Spring AOP/IOC思维导图源码笔记)【图】

Spring AOP/IOC思维脑图需要获取完整高清版Spring AOP/IOC思维脑图与源码笔记的老铁请转发+关注,然后私信回复“笔记”获得免费领取方式!AOP原理 AOP术语 Spring对AOP的支持 知识点 需要获取完整高清版Spring AOP/IOC思维脑图与源码笔记的老铁请转发+关注,然后私信回复“笔记”获得免费领取方式!IOC和DI的概念 使用IOC的好处 IOC容器 IOC容器装配Bean Spring AOP/IOC源码笔记 这个【Spring AOP/IOC源码笔记】是全程手打肛...

Java SpringBoot 捕获异常【代码】

Java SpringBoot 捕获异常 自定义异常类 JwtExceptionUtils @Data public class JwtExceptionUtils extends RuntimeException {private EnumDeclare.Code code;public JwtExceptionUtils(EnumDeclare.Code code, String message) {super(message);this.code = code;} }捕捉类 GlobalExceptionHandler @ControllerAdvice @ResponseBody public class GlobalExceptionHandler {/*** 全局异常捕获, 处理登录失败或token失效异常** @r...

蘑菇街Java大牛纯手写肛出的(Spring AOP/IOC思维导图源码笔记)【图】

Spring AOP/IOC思维脑图需要获取完整高清版Spring AOP/IOC思维脑图与源码笔记的老铁请转发+关注,然后加我VX【tkzl6666】获得免费领取方式!AOP原理AOP术语Spring对AOP的支持知识点需要获取完整高清版Spring AOP/IOC思维脑图与源码笔记的老铁请转发+关注,然后加我VX【tkzl6666】获得免费领取方式!IOC和DI的概念使用IOC的好处IOC容器IOC容器装配BeanSpring AOP/IOC源码笔记这个【Spring AOP/IOC源码笔记】是全程手打肛出来的,共1...

Java程序员,这两本书必须看:Spring实战+深入实践SpringBoot【图】

《Spring实战》本书从核心的Spring、Spring应用程序的核心组件、Spring集成3个方面,由浅 入深、由易到难地对Spring展开了系统的讲解,包括Spring之旅、装配Bean、最小 化Spring XML配置、面向切面的Spring、征服数据库、事务管理、使用Spring MVC 构建Web应用程序、使用Spring Web Flow,保护Spring应用、使用远程服务、为 Spring添加REST功能、Spring消息、使用JMX管理Spring Bean以及其他Spring技 巧等内容。 本书适用于已具有一...

银四过半,吃透这些SpringBoot笔记文档,超过90%的Java面试者【图】

前言 做 Java 开发,没有人敢小觑 Spring Boot 的重要性,现在出去面试,无论多小的公司 or 项目,都要跟你扯一扯 Spring Boot,扯一扯微服务,如果啃不下来,很可能就与大厂失之交臂。 精通Spring Boot的原理实现的话,可以帮助你更好地职业进阶,学习前辈优秀的架构设计思想,总结出最优使用方案,绕过工作中遇到的很多坑。 一个框架的源码也是最大的知识库,源码是一层一层嵌套的,光靠文字说明会比较难以理解,最好是在IDE环境...